SANTIAGO.- The leader in batting average last season, JC Escarra, was announced to join the team from this Tuesday 21st and will be available to enter into action immediately. In fact, he was included in the weekly roster of the eagle team.

Last Sunday, prior to the game in which the Águilas Cibaeñas shut out the Tigres del Licey 4-0 at the Cibao Stadium, the team’s manager, Luis “Pipe” Urueta, revealed that the effective batter and catcher would be arriving in the country during the current week.
“I don’t know the exact date, but Escarra is scheduled to arrive in the country this week, through the Cibao Airport,” said Urueta.
The manager valued the integration of the player, who with his outstanding performance was a key piece in the trouble-free classification of the 22-time national champions, calling his arrival an important injection for the team.
Likewise, Pipe Urueta showed great satisfaction with the performance of the young material of the Águilas Cibaeñas, assuring that it is a group with enough talent to stand out in this league.
“I think what we have seen in these games is that all the teams have shown their potential, and we have gathered a group of very talented young players who can excel in this league, both for their offense and for their defensive dynamism,” said the manager.
Precisely that Sunday, the novice Adael Amador offered a recital of good defensive plays and was a key factor with his bat in the victory of that day.
Urueta also spoke about the adjustments that the Águilas are making in their starting rotation.
“One of the adjustments we must make is in the starting pitching, from which we expect an improvement in its performance. Obviously, in the first game Spencer did a decent job as a starter, but they are definitely adjustments that we have to continue making,” he pointed out.
